Customizing Plant Arrangements for Different Spaces
Creating harmonious plant arrangements tailored to specific spaces is a fine art practiced by professional interior plant designers. When it comes to offices, for instance, plant selection and placement play a vital role in fostering productivity and creating an inviting atmosphere. A designer will consider factors like natural light availability, space constraints, and the desired aesthetic to curate plants that thrive in those conditions. For larger spaces, strategic grouping of plants can help define areas within the office while smaller potted plants on desks or shelves bring nature closer to employees, boosting morale and concentration.
In contrast, public spaces demand a different approach. Design for these areas often involves selecting robust plants capable of withstanding varying light conditions and foot traffic. Balancing aesthetics and practicality is key, ensuring plants not only enhance the visual appeal but also contribute to air purification. Professional designers understand these nuances, offering customized solutions that transform ordinary spaces into vibrant oases where people can thrive.

Benefits and Maintenance Tips for Longevity
Interior plant design offers more than just aesthetic appeal; it provides numerous benefits that enhance spaces and improve well-being. For homes, offices, and public areas alike, incorporating plants can create a calming atmosphere, boost productivity, and even improve air quality by absorbing toxins and releasing oxygen. This natural touch adds personality to any space, fostering a sense of tranquility and connection with nature.
Regular maintenance is key to ensuring these living additions thrive and remain vibrant. Simple tasks like watering according to each plant’s needs, providing adequate sunlight, and occasional pruning help keep them healthy. Additionally, monitoring light levels, soil conditions, and humidity ensures optimal growth. For offices with plant design, it’s beneficial to involve professionals who understand the unique challenges of indoor spaces and can provide tailored care instructions for a thriving green environment that enhances productivity and employee satisfaction.
